Virtual
Tour

FET Blogs

BTech AI and ML Syllabus, Subjects, Course Details and Duration

10 March 2026

BTech AI and ML Syllabus, Subjects, Course Details and Duration

What if machines could not only follow instructions but also think, learn, and make decisions like humans?

This is no longer science fiction. It is the reality created by Artificial Intelligence and Machine Learning, two revolutionary technologies transforming the way we live and work.

Choosing a career in AI and ML places you at the centre of innovation in one of the fastest-growing and most future-proof domains globally.

As industries increasingly adopt automation and data-driven strategies, the demand for skilled professionals continues to rise across healthcare, finance, robotics, cybersecurity, gaming, and many other sectors.

You can consider pursuing a Bachelor of Technology (BTech) in Artificial Intelligence and Machine Learning   that will help you build the expertise and skills required to build intelligent systems and data-driven solutions.

The blog aims to cover insights on BTech AI and ML course details and syllabus to help   you make an informed career decision.

Overview of BTech AI and ML

BTech in Artificial Intelligence and Machine Learning is a four-year undergraduate programme that prepares you to build intelligent systems capable of learning, reasoning, and decision-making.

The AIML subjects in BTech course combine strong theoretical foundations with practical applications to help you innovate and develop smart technologies.

Besides studying the B tech Artificial Intelligence subjects, you will also study advanced topics like Deep Learning, Human-Computer Interaction, Augmented Reality, robotics, and edge computing. The table below discusses BTech AI and ML course details:

Course Name   Bachelor of Technology (BTech) in Artificial Intelligence and Machine Learning
Level of Education   Undergraduate
Duration   Four Years
Eligibility   Pass 10+2 with at least 50% marks from a recognised board in the Science stream
Admission Process   Merit or entrance-based
Career Opportunities
  1.   Data Analyst
  2. Junior Data Scientist
  3. Junior Data Engineer
  4. Junior Computer Vision Engineer

BTech AI ML Course Duration and Eligibility

The course duration of the BTech AI and ML programme is four years, divided into eight semesters.

To be eligible for the course, you must pass 10+2 with at least 50% marks from a recognised board in the Science stream. You must also have a background in PCM (Physics, Chemistry, Mathematics) in 10+2.

Additionally, you must also qualify for entrance exams to secure admissions in the top universities   of the country. Some of the common entrance exams are as follows:

  1. Joint Entrance Examination (JEE)
  2. Consortium of Medical, Engineering and Dental Colleges of Karnataka Undergraduate Entrance Test (COMEDK)
  3. Karnataka Common Entrance Test (KCET)
  4. Common University Entrance Test (CUET)

Some universities also conduct institute-specific exams. You can check all the details related to the entrance exam on the university’s official website or contact the admissions office directly.

BTech AI ML Syllabus

The B Tech CSE AIML syllabus focuses on programming machines using languages and tools that enable automation and customisation of intelligent systems.

You will study BTech AI ML subjects such as knowledge representation, probabilistic models, reasoning methods, and algorithm design. The table below gives a semester-wise breakdown of the BTech AI ML subjects:

Semester-I Semester-II
Computational Physics Computer Organisation and Architecture
Computational Mathematics Programming practices using JAVA
Electrical and Electronics for Computational Thinking Mind Management and Human Values-II
Mind Management and Human Values-1 Data Structures using JAVA
Design Thinking and Complex Problem Solving Design and Analysis of Algorithms
Discrete Mathematics and Graph Theory Introduction to Python Programming
Computational Chemistry Operating Systems
Project Centric Learning Communicative English
  Workshop Practices
  Project - 1
Semester-III Semester-IV
Foundations of Mathematics - 1 Foundations of Mathematics - 2+
Advanced Python Programming Web Dev and Apps for Data Science
Database Management Systems Biology for Engineers
Fundamentals of Artificial Intelligence Computer Networks
Mathematics and Statistics for Machine Learning Advanced Machine Learning
Causal Reasoning Time Series and Forecasting Techniques
Data Exploration and Preparation Essentials of Data Warehousing and Data mining
Elective - 1 Environmental Studies
Machine Learning Business Communication and Storytelling
Numerical Optimisation Internship - 1
Open Elective - 1 Project - II
Project Centric Learning  
Semester-V Semester-VI
DevOps for AI Advanced Deep Learning
Essentials of Deep Learning Research Methodology
Indian Constitutions Elective - 3
Introduction to Natural Language Processing Ethics and Values (CSR)
Elective - 2 Internship - 2
Leadership and Negotiation skills Internship - 2
Open Elective -2 Project -III
Project Centric Learning  
Semester-VII Semester-VIII
NoSQL Databases Internship -3
Data Streaming and Analysis Research
Intellectual Property Rights  
Computer Vision and Image Processing  
Elective -4  
Open Elective -3  
Open Elective -4  
Elective -5  
Project -IV  

Let us take a look at the departmental-specific elective BTech AI ML subjects offered in the   syllabus:

DSE Tracks Elective-I Elective-II Elective-III Elective-IV Elective-V
5th Semester 6th Semester 6th Semester 7th Semester 7th Semester
Track - I Internet of Things Reinforcement Learning Data Visualisation and Storytelling Cloud and Distributed Computing ESG Analytics
Track - II Applications of AI Blockchain Technologies for Data Science Information Security Governance Introduction to Big Data Network Analytics
Track - III Smart Contracts Geographic Information Systems (GIS) and Applications User Experience User Interface Design (UX &UI) Speech recognition and conversational systems Microservice Architecture

Final Thoughts

Artificial Intelligence and Machine Learning are driving the next wave of global innovation across   industries.

Studying BTech in AI and ML will help you to access the competitive job market and will bring you a sense of stability and long-term growth.

It is high time to act if you ar  e fond of technology and innovation.

Explore   the BTech AI and ML programme at top institutions such as JAIN (Deemed-to-be-University) to build a future-ready and high-impact career.

FAQs

Q1: What is BTech in AI and ML?

A1: BTech in AI and ML is a four-year undergraduate programme that focuses on building intelligent systems using Artificial Intelligence and Machine Learning technologies.

It combines programming, mathematics, and data-driven techniques to develop smart applications.

Q2: What are the subjects in CSE AI and ML?

A2: The BTech CSE AI and ML syllabus includes subjects like Programming, Data Structures, Machine Learning, Deep Learning, Artificial Intelligence, Data Science, Probability, Statistics, and Computer Vision.

The BTech CSE AI and ML syllabus also covers emerging areas such as Natural Language Processing and Robotics.

Q3: Is there a growing career in Artificial Intelligence and Machine Learning courses?

A3: Yes. AI and ML are rapidly expanding fields with strong demand across industries like healthcare, finance, e-commerce, and technology.

Q4: Is BTech in AI good for future?

A4: BTech in AI is considered future-ready as Artificial Intelligence is transforming industries worldwide. The degree offers strong career prospects, innovation opportunities, and global relevance.

Ask an Expert for Free

Enter your Name
Enter E-mail id Invalid E-mail id
Mobile number is required Enter 10 number Minimum Invalid pattern
Enter Your Message